The norite belt in the Mesoarchaean Maniitsoq structure, southern West Greenland: conduit-type Ni-Cu mineralisation in impact-triggered, mantle-derived intrusions?

With the recent discovery of the giant, deeply eroded, 3 GaManiitsoq impact structure in southern West Greenland(Garde 2010), an enigmatic, c. 75 by 15 km large, curvilinearbelt of undeformed norite intrusions with Ni-Cu mineralisationwas re-interpreted as representing crustally contaminatedmelts derived from the mantle in the wake of the impact(Fig. 1; Garde et al. 2012). The norite belt (Nielsen 1976;Secher 1983) was discovered in the early 1960s by the miningand exploration company Kryolitselskabet ?resund A/S,and more than one hundred shallow exploration holes weredrilled by the company in the period 1965–1971. The mineralisationhas subsequently been investigated by ComincoLtd., Falconbridge Ltd. and NunaMinerals A/S. In 2011, there-interpretation of the norite belt, and recent availability ofimproved airborne geophysical exploration tools, promptedthe Canadian company North American Nickel Inc. (NAN)to resume exploration.
